Ohio 6 1/4 Cent Rate Covers
The 6 1/4 cent rate is a phantom rate; it never existed for U.S. mail.  The official rate was 6 cents, which was difficult to pay in U.S. coinage.  Fractional Spanish colonial currency circulated freely in the United States as legal tender until 1857, and 6 1/4 cents corresponds precisely with 1/2 real (8 reales being equivalent to a United States dollar).  Covers bearing a 6 1/4 rate are generally prepaid and reflect a postmaster correctly accounting for the actual amount collected by him for the letter. 

See "The Pickayune Rate", Ohio Postal History Journal Issue #103 (March 2003), page 6.  The 6 1/4 cent rate was also mentioned in the Spring 1977 issue of the Journal, in a J.K. Gibson article.  For more information on the impact of coinage generally on postal rates, see Richard Frajola's Postal Charges and Payment Methods in the United States 1792-1921.
